VCSH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

1,239 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Short-Term Corporate Bond ETF (VCSH)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$25.5B — down 17% from $30.6B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 98 funds closed out of VCSH and 94 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 527 trimmed existing stakes and 469 added.

The largest buyer was American Family Insurance Mutual Holding, adding an estimated $184M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$763M.
